How to Find a Private Psychiatrist in the UK
Finding the right mental health care specialist can be a difficult task, particularly when considering private psychiatry. The UK uses a varied variety of mental health services, however many individuals seeking treatment typically choose the tailored approach that private psychiatrists offer. This post will assist you through the actions required to find a private psychiatrist in the UK, what factors to think about, and responses to regularly asked questions.
Understanding Private Psychiatry
Private psychiatry describes mental healthcare services offered by professionals who operate outside the National Health Service (NHS). Patients who choose private psychiatry frequently look for quicker access to appointments, a wider choice of experts, and numerous treatment options that may not be available through civil services.
Benefits of Private PsychiatryReduced Waiting Times: Patients frequently experience considerably shorter wait times for visits.Versatile Scheduling: Appointment times can be more accommodating to the patient's needs.Personalized Care: Patients may have more chances for one-on-one time with their psychiatrist.Access to Specialists: Availability of a wider series of specialties and treatment methods.Steps to Find a Private Psychiatrist
The procedure of discovering a private psychiatrist involves numerous crucial steps. The following guide lays out these actions in detail:
1. Determine Your Needs
Before you start searching for a psychiatrist, it's important to understand what you need. Think about the following:
Type of Therapy Needed: Are you looking for medication management, psychotherapy, or both?Specialization: Some psychiatrists specialize in particular locations, such as anxiety conditions, depression, ADHD, or injury.Preferred Treatment Methods: Some experts might integrate alternative therapies or prefer evidence-based medication, so it's important to know what you're searching for.2. Research Potential Psychiatrists
Conduct comprehensive research to compile a list of possible psychiatrists. Here are some resources to consider:
Online Directories: Websites like the Royal College of Psychiatrists, Therapy Directory, or Psychology Today can offer listings of qualified psychiatrists in your location.Word of Mouth: Recommendations from family, pals, or other health care experts can lead you to trusted psychiatrists.Insurance coverage Providers: If you have private medical insurance, check which psychiatrists are covered under your strategy.3. Inspect Qualifications and Experience
Once you have a list, it's important to confirm each prospect's qualifications. Search for:
Medical Qualifications: Ensure that the psychiatrist is regist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) and belongs to an expert body, such as the Royal College of Psychiatrists.Experience: Review their experience in treating your particular condition.Client Reviews: Online evaluations or testimonials can offer extra insights into the psychiatrist's method and effectiveness.4. Schedule an Initial Consultation
A preliminary assessment can assist you identify if a psychiatrist is the best suitable for you. Throughout this go to, think about:

How do I understand if I need to see a psychiatrist?
If you are experiencing relentless symptoms impacting your daily life, such as extreme state of mind swings, stress and anxiety, depression, or modifications in behavior, it may be time to consider speaking with a psychiatrist.
2. Can I self-refer to a private psychiatrist?
Yes, people can self-refer to private psychiatrists without requiring a recommendation from a GP, which is often needed for NHS services.
3. Will my insurance cover the costs of a private psychiatrist?
Numerous private health insurance prepares deal coverage for professional psychiatric services, but it's crucial to examine your specific policy details.
4. What can I expect throughout my first consultation?
During the very first consultation, you can anticipate to discuss your signs, individual history, treatment goals, and any concerns you may have concerning the treatment process.
5. How long will I require to see a psychiatrist?
The period of treatment varies commonly depending upon the individual's requirements and the intricacy of their condition. Regular continuous evaluations will assist identify the ongoing requirement of sessions.
